Bayern Munich’s increasingly drawn-out coaching search got you down? Just imagine how it is for the players, who are also sorting out a disappointing Bundesliga season and still-alive Champions League campaign on the side.
If there were ever a test of maintaining focus, this is it.
“Of course it’s a topic in the dressing room, but it doesn’t put a strain on us as a team at all,” Bayern winger Serge Gnabry stated after Saturday’s match against VfB Stuttgart (as captured by @iMiaSanMia). “What else are we supposed to do do? I’m sure the right solution will be found.”
If results are anything to go by, however, the rumor mill is taking its toll at least a little. Bayern looked out of sorts in its 1-3 road defeat to Stuttgart and will have to sort things out quickly before Wednesday’s match on the road against Real Madrid.
A new coach, and clarity, was supposed to be nearly in place by then. Now the future is cloudier than ever — but that may be just the impetus Bayern needs to get locked in the present.
